Lacock Circular is a 6.5 mile loop trail located near Melksham, Wiltshire, England that features a river and is rated as moderate. The trail is primarily used for hiking, walking, running, and nature trips.
This trail has lovely views and is a beautiful area to explore. Bear in mind there is one stretch, however, which is on a road without any path so be careful of cars. This is dog friendly and they can mainly be off the lead for most of the walk (though at certain times of the year they have sheep and cows grazing so your dog would have to be on a lead then) and the route is easily followed.
